Motion Simulator
The Motion Simulator is used as a Performance-Based Design tool to define a suitable target performance level for the dynamic behavior of occupied structures (such as building, bridges, floor systems, etc).
In the simulator, the design team can accurately replicate and explore true-to-life motions for a range of design scenarios.
Data Mining
Having had experience with physical and analytical modeling on thousands of projects worldwide, RWDI has accumulated a tremendous data resource that helps clients receive high quality consulting services that lead to faster consultations, improved designs and cost savings.
This data can be 'mined' for similar projects allowing RWDI consultants to review the original tests and reanalyze the data in combination with site-specific properties (e.g., shape, weather climate) to predict results for a proposed project at the new location.
This approach works well for the first-order estimates needed early in the design process and helps substantiate the experience of our consultants.

Water Flume
Soon after the development of the water flume technique to simulate winds and drifting snow conditions, RWDI began providing consulting services to clients.
A water flume is a specifically designed tank that introduces fine sand into deep flowing water that envelops a scale model of buildings and roads to simulate the effects of wind and blowing snow.
